esword is a free bible study software. I have about 12 bibles and several commentaries. Once you download and install ,there is a download link in the program window to download bibles and commentaries. You can also do an internet search for additional content. I found some premium content on the internet that I would otherwise have to pay for. Esword recently updated so old .bbl files don't work only the new .bblx files work. well worth the time. here is the link.
